Trip Overview

The drive from Ashland, VA to Alexandria, VA covers 87.7 miles and takes about 1h 45m behind the wheel. This route is realistic as a one-day drive if you keep your stops efficient.

The route leans on I 95, Capital Beltway (Local), England Street for much of the mileage, and the overall profile is highway-focused drive. The longest uninterrupted segment is about 81.5 miles on I 95. At current regular gas prices, budget about $13.71 one way before food or hotel costs.

Drive Character

This is a 1h 45m highway drive covering 87.7 miles, with most of the trip on I 95 and Capital Beltway (Local). The longest continuous stretch is about 81.5 miles on I 95.

Most of the miles stay on highways, which makes pacing and fuel planning easier than turn-by-turn city driving.
There are about 17 navigation steps in the underlying route data, so the final approach matters more than the middle miles.
I 95 is the longest continuous segment at about 81.5 miles.
